33 /* This pass combines COND_EXPRs to simplify control flow. It
34 currently recognizes bit tests and comparisons in chains that
35 represent logical and or logical or of two COND_EXPRs.
37 It does so by walking basic blocks in a approximate reverse
38 post-dominator order and trying to match CFG patterns that
39 represent logical and or logical or of two COND_EXPRs.
40 Transformations are done if the COND_EXPR conditions match
41 either
43 1. two single bit tests X & (1 << Yn) (for logical and)
45 2. two bit tests X & Yn (for logical or)
47 3. two comparisons X OPn Y (for logical or)
49 To simplify this pass, removing basic blocks and dead code
50 is left to CFG cleanup and DCE. */
